Make sure the device is powered on and that it has enough battery life to transfer pictures.

If the tablet shuts off during a transfer, you risk data corruption, making your pictures unviewable. Next, plug the USB 2. It will detect the connection and notify you download photos from pc to kindle fire its screen.

Part 2. Locate the pictures on your computer. Using a file browser, navigate through your folders until you find the pictures you want to transfer.

Copy the pictures. Select the picture you want to transfer by clicking on it. On Windows, head for My Computer. On Mac, the Kindle Fire should appear on the desktop with a hard drive icon. Locate the Pictures folder. Double-click the Pictures folder to open it. Here you can paste the pictures that you copied from your computer. Transfer the pictures into your Kindle Fire.

Wait for the transfer to finish. The progress bar will disappear once the pictures has been copied onto download photos from pc to kindle fire Kindle Fire. Disconnect your Kindle Fire from the computer. You will hear a sound notification from your computer, letting you know that disconnection was successful.

After hearing the notification, remove the cable both from the Kindle Fire and the PC. Part 3. Head for the Gallery. Tap the Посмотреть еще album. Since you copied the pictures into the Pictures folder, you should be able to view them by tapping the Pictures folder.
